Start your bachelor party weekend with a visit to the famous Baga Beach. In the morning, enjoy the sun, sand, and surf while indulging in beach activities like beach volleyball and jet skiing. For lunch, head to one of the beachside shacks to savor delicious seafood.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ant markets of Baga and shop for souvenirs and beachwear. In the evening, experience the buzzing nightlife at the beach clubs and bars. Dance the night away and celebrate the start of a memorable weekend!
Embark on an adventurous day trip to Dudhsagar Falls, one of the most magnificent waterfalls in India. In the morning, take a scenic drive through the lush countryside to reach the falls. Spend the afternoon exploring the area, hiking to the viewpoint, and taking a refreshing dip in the natural pool. Don't forget to capture the breathtaking beauty of the cascading waterfalls. In the evening, head back to Goa and unwind at a beachside restaurant with delicious Goan cuisine.
Conclude your bachelor party weekend with a thrilling casino cruise experience. In the morning, relax on the beach and soak up the Goan sun. In the afternoon, board a luxurious casino cruise ship and try your luck at the various games and slot machines. Enjoy live entertainment, indulge in the buffet dinner spread, and dance to the tunes of the resident DJ. As the night unfolds, savor the excitement of gambling and celebrate your last night in Goa in style!
If you have extra time during your bachelor party weekend in Goa, consider visiting Calangute Beach, known for its lively atmosphere and water sports. Another option is to take a day trip to the historic Old Goa, where you can explore colonial churches and learn about Goa's rich history.
